邊緣加速技術詳解:如何利用邊緣計算提升網絡性能與用戶體驗

2 分钟阅读
2026-03-09
2026-03-11
2,615
當您透過下方連結購物時,我會獲得佣金,而您無需支付額外费用。.

在當今以數據爲中心的數字世界中,用戶對應用性能的期望達到了前所未有的高度。網絡延遲往往是影響體驗的關鍵瓶頸,傳統的集中式雲計算架構將數據處理集中在少數幾個大型數據中心,數據在用戶與服務器之間的長途跋涉不可避免地導致了延遲。邊緣計算應運而生,它將計算、存儲和網絡資源從中心雲“下沉”到更靠近用戶或數據產生源的物理位置,即網絡的“邊緣”。邊緣加速正是這一架構變革的核心技術體現,它通過在網絡邊緣執行關鍵任務,顯著縮短數據傳輸路徑,從而降低延遲、節約帶寬並提升整體服務可靠性。

边缘加速的核心原理

邊緣加速並非單一技術,而是一套綜合性的技術策略和架構方案。其核心思想是“就近處理,就近響應”,將靜態內容緩存、動態請求處理、API調用甚至部分計算邏輯從中心服務器遷移到分佈廣泛的邊緣節點上。

推荐阅读 CDN技术详解:从工作原理到选型实践,全面指南助你加速网站访问速度

算力與內容的下沉

傳統的互聯網訪問模式遵循“用戶 -> 骨幹網 -> 中心雲 -> 骨幹網 -> 用戶”的路徑。邊緣加速在這一路徑中插入了邊緣節點。這些節點可以是電信運營商的基站機房、地區性的微型數據中心或部署在企業本地的專用設備。當用戶發起請求時,智能調度系統(如基於DNS或Anycast的全局負載均衡)會將請求路由至地理位置和網絡拓撲上最近的、具備服務能力的邊緣節點。

智能請求路由與緩存

這是邊緣加速的基石。邊緣節點通常配備有強大的緩存能力。對於靜態資源(如圖片、CSS、JavaScript、視頻點播流),邊緣節點可以直接從本地緩存中返回,訪問速度極快。對於動態內容,邊緣節點可以作爲反向代理,優化與源站(中心雲或私有數據中心)的連接,例如通過合併請求、使用更優的傳輸協議(如QUIC)或進行協議優化來減少延遲。

兔子網站(bunny.net)的內容分發網络(CDN)
兔子網站(bunny.net)的內容分發網络(CDN)
每月仅需 1 美元起,费用清晰透明。平台支持永久缓存、实时监控、DDoS 防护和免费 SSL 证书,专为视频流优化而设计,还提供按使用量计费的灵活模式。
无需信用卡,可免费试用 14 天。
访问 bunny.net 的内容分发网络(CDN)→
Cloudways Cloudflare 企业版
Cloudways Cloudflare 企业版
Cloudflare 企业级 CDN/WAF 的定价方案为:5 个域名以内,每个域名每月 4.99 美元,包含 100GB 流量,超出部分按 0.02 美元/GB 收费。
每个域名赠送 100GB 流量
访问Cloudways的Cloudflare企业版服务 →

邊緣加速的關鍵技術棧

實現有效的邊緣加速依賴於一系列協同工作的技術組件。

推荐阅读 CDN 技術詳解:如何加速網站內容分發與提升用戶體驗

邊緣服務器與無服務器邊緣計算

早期邊緣加速主要通過內容分發網絡的緩存節點實現。如今,隨着邊緣計算平臺的發展,邊緣節點進化成了能夠運行自定義代碼的輕量級服務器。開發者可以將函數或微服務直接部署在全球分佈的邊緣節點上,這就是無服務器邊緣計算。例如,用戶身份驗證、A/B測試邏輯、實時圖像處理或API聚合都可以在邊緣完成,無需回源,實現毫秒級響應。

全局負載均衡與智能DNS

決定用戶請求被哪個邊緣節點處理是第一道關卡。智能DNS會根據用戶IP解析出地理位置上最近的邊緣節點IP。更先進的全局負載均衡器則能綜合考慮節點健康狀態、實時負載、網絡擁塞情況,做出最優路由決策,確保高可用性和高性能。

安全與隱私增強

邊緣加速同樣帶來了安全範式的轉變。分佈式拒絕服務攻擊可以在邊緣被識別和緩解,惡意流量在到達源站前就被攔截。同時,隱私數據可以在更靠近用戶的區域進行處理和匿名化,滿足數據本地化存儲的法律法規要求。邊緣節點與源站之間、以及邊緣節點之間的通信通常採用端到端加密,保障數據安全。

推荐阅读 CDN是什麼?解析內容分發網絡的工作原理與核心優勢

边缘加速的主要应用场景

邊緣加速技術正在深刻改變多個行業的服務交付方式。

实时交互式应用程序

在線遊戲、視頻會議、遠程協作工具和金融交易平臺對延遲極度敏感。邊緣加速通過將遊戲邏輯處理、視頻流合成轉碼或交易指令處理放在邊緣,可以大幅降低操作延時,避免卡頓,提供流暢的實時體驗。例如,雲遊戲服務商利用邊緣節點運行遊戲實例,使玩家幾乎感覺不到與本地遊戲的差異。

大量内容分发与流媒体服务

這是邊緣加速最經典的應用。視頻點播、直播流媒體、軟件下載和網站靜態資源分發通過邊緣網絡能實現高效傳遞。熱門的視頻內容會主動緩存在各大區域的邊緣節點,當海量用戶同時請求時,流量被有效分散,源站壓力驟減,用戶也能獲得快速加載和高清無卡頓的觀看體驗。

IoT與萬物互聯

物聯網設備產生海量時序數據,將所有這些數據直接上傳到中心雲處理既昂貴又低效。邊緣加速架構允許在靠近設備側的網關或本地邊緣服務器上進行數據過濾、清洗、聚合和初步分析,只將關鍵信息或摘要結果上傳至雲端。這降低了帶寬成本,並實現了設備的實時本地響應,對於工業自動化、智能城市、車聯網等領域至關重要。

推荐阅读 CDN加速原理与最佳实践:如何提升网站性能和用户体验

实施边缘加速的挑战与考量

儘管優勢明顯,但採納邊緣加速架構也面臨一些挑戰,需要在實施前仔細規劃。

一致性與狀態管理

當應用邏輯分佈在成百上千個邊緣節點時,如何保證全局狀態和數據的一致性成爲難題。例如,用戶的購物車信息需要在不同邊緣節點間同步。解決方案通常包括使用分佈式數據庫、最終一致性模型或將有狀態請求通過“粘性會話”定向到特定節點或直接回源處理。

開發與運維複雜性

管理一個全球分佈式的邊緣環境比管理單一中心雲環境更爲複雜。應用的部署、配置更新、監控和故障排查都需要新的工具和流程。開發者需要適應分佈式編程模型,考慮網絡分區、節點失效等場景。選擇成熟的邊緣計算平臺可以大幅降低這部分複雜度。

成本與資源權衡

雖然邊緣加速節省了帶寬成本並提升了性能,但邊緣計算資源本身可能按需計費且分佈廣泛。需要精細化的成本監控和優化策略,例如根據業務需求動態調整邊緣函數的部署區域和資源規格,合理設置緩存策略以平衡命中率和存儲成本。

推荐阅读 CDN技術詳解:工作原理、應用場景與加速效果全面解析

总结

邊緣加速是利用邊緣計算範式提升網絡性能與用戶體驗的系統性方法。它通過將計算和內容推向網絡邊緣,從根本上縮短了數據往返距離,實現了低延遲、高吞吐和高可用的服務目標。其技術棧涵蓋了從智能路由、邊緣緩存到無服務器計算等多個層面,廣泛應用於實時交互、內容分發和物聯網等場景。儘管在一致性、運維和成本方面存在挑戰,但隨着技術平臺的成熟和標準化的推進,邊緣加速正從一種優化手段演變爲現代應用架構的默認選擇,爲下一代互聯網應用奠定堅實的技術基礎。

常见问题解答(FAQ)

邊緣加速和傳統的CDN有什麼區別?

传统的CDN主要专注于静态内容的缓存和分发,其节点功能相对固定,主要以缓存和转发为主。

而現代邊緣加速平臺建立在CDN的分佈式架構之上,但提供了可編程的計算能力。它允許開發者在邊緣節點運行自定義的業務邏輯,處理動態請求和實時計算,是CDN功能的超集,從“內容分發”進化到了“應用分發”。

邊緣加速是否意味着不再需要中心雲?

並非如此。中心雲和邊緣計算是互補的架構。中心雲更適合處理需要強大集中計算能力、全局數據聚合分析、深度機器學習訓練或涉及全局強一致性的後臺任務。

邊緣加速則負責處理低延遲、高頻率的實時請求和數據預處理。兩者通常協同工作,形成“雲-邊-端”協同的層次化計算模型。

如何開始實施邊緣加速策略?

對於大多數團隊,建議從利用現有的邊緣計算平臺開始。許多主流雲服務商和專門的邊緣服務提供商都提供了成熟的邊緣計算服務。

首先,可以將應用的靜態資源託管到其邊緣網絡。然後,嘗試將部分無狀態、對延遲敏感的API或業務邏輯(如用戶身份驗證、個性化內容組裝)改造成邊緣函數進行部署。通過漸進式遷移,觀察性能指標和成本變化,逐步優化架構。

邊緣加速對網站的安全性有什麼影響?

合理的邊緣加速架構通常會增強應用的安全性。邊緣節點可以作爲安全屏障,實施Web應用防火牆、DDoS緩解和機器人程序管理,將威脅阻擋在遠離源站的地方。

同時,由於邊緣節點更靠近用戶,可以更快地實施安全策略更新。但這也帶來了新的安全考量,例如需要確保邊緣函數代碼的安全、管理更多可能的外部攻擊面,以及保障邊緣節點與源站之間通信的加密與認證。